The Fisher Roulette Betting Strategy

This betting strategy is not as popular as some other systems such as the D’Alembert or the Martingale, but it can be an effective tool when playing roulette. Since it focuses on outside even-money bets, we suggest using this strategy when playing at a European roulette wheel, preferably a French roulette variant.

The Fisher betting strategy is better suited for casual players because it’s similar to the Martingale strategy in many ways, but it reduces the risk of running out of budget. Namely, the strategy works like this: you should determine a unit size, and place 1 unit wager on an even-money bet such as Red/Black.

If you win, the strategy restarts. If you lose, you should place another 1 unit bet. If you lose again, you should place another 1 unit bet. After 4 consecutive losses, you should increase the bet size by x3. So, in the 5th bet, you should wager 3 units. If you win, you reset. If you lose, you continue with triple the bet size. If you lose 4 consecutive bets again, you triple the bet size again until you win.

This strategy is a good option because, unlike the standard Martingale system, it reduces the risk of running out of budget or reaching the table limits because it’s unlikely to lose so many times in a row.

The $150 Roulette Betting System

This strategy is best suited for high rollers. Although it can be played with lower bet sizes, the nature of the strategy will likely require you to wager significant amounts. So, how does the strategy work?

The starting budget is $150 – hence the name. You should place $50 on two of the three Dozens on the roulette betting grid. For example, you can bet on the 1st 12 and 2nd 12. With the remaining $50, you should place $5 straight-up bets on 10 of the 12 remaining spaces on the third Dozen that you haven’t covered. This means that there will be three numbers on the wheel that haven’t been covered: the 0 and two other numbers.

If the ball lands on a number that you have a Dozen bet on, you will win with 3:1 payout ratio, and you will break even. If the ball lands on one of the numbers you have a straight-up bet, you will come out with $30 in profit. If the ball lands on one of the numbers you haven’t covered, you lose.

The outcome of the spin when betting with $150 Strategy Chances of that happening in percentage
The Ball lands on one of the bets covered by a Dozen bet 64.86%
The ball lands on one of the numbers you have covered with a straight-up bet and you win 27.03%
The ball lands on a number you haven’t covered 8.10%

As you can see from the table above, the chances of winning when using the $150 roulette betting strategy are 27.03%. The chances of breaking even with each spin are 64.86%, while the chances of losing your $150 wager are 8.10%. This is a riskier strategy, so it’s best suitable for players with deeper pockets. However, you have a 91.89% chance of winning or breaking even, which is higher when compared to most other betting strategies.

Sports viewing has quietly changed its personality in Nigeria. It is no longer just about sitting in front of a TV and following a match from start to finish. It has become something more layered, constant, and social, stretching across both physical spaces and digital platforms.

From viewing centres and barbershops to X feeds and WhatsApp groups, football is no longer watched in isolation; it is experienced collectively, even when people are not in the same room. Platforms like GOtv have also supported this shift by making football more accessible and consistent, helping fans stay plugged into live matches and highlights without missing key moments. But beyond access, what has truly changed is the culture around the game and how conversations now live far beyond the screen.

There was a time when football talk had a clear beginning and end. You watched the match at a viewing centre, a neighbour’s house, or wherever there was a working screen, and that was where everything happened. The arguments, celebrations, and banter stayed in that space. Once you left, the conversation faded until the next match day. Football was social, but it was also limited by time and place.

Then social media changed everything. What used to stay in viewing centres now spills across the entire day. A goal is no longer just a moment in a match; it becomes a tweet, a meme, a hot take, and a debate within seconds. Rival fans respond instantly, stats are shared, and the same incident is argued from multiple angles across different platforms. Football didn’t just become more visible; it became continuous.

Viewing centres used to be the main social hub for football culture. That was where strangers bonded, arguments felt personal, and every match had a shared energy. Today, that barrier is gone. Football is no longer tied to a location. Someone is watching highlights in traffic, another is following updates at work, while others are debating online while the match is still ongoing. The reaction now runs alongside the game itself.

This shift has changed the emotional rhythm of football. The conversation no longer ends at full-time. It continues through post-match analysis, memes, tactical debates, and recycled clips that keep rivalries alive long after the final whistle. Football has become less of a fixed event and more of a constant social stream.

Ultimately, the desire behind watching football has not changed. People still want to celebrate, argue, and feel part of something bigger. What has changed is where that experience happens. It is no longer confined to one screen or one space; it now exists everywhere at once.

That is why sports viewing today feels more social than ever, not because the matches have changed, but because the conversation around them never stops.

MultiChoice, a CANAL+ company, has introduced special World Cup bundle offers on DStv and GOtv to give more Nigerians access to football’s biggest event.

From Monday, June 1, 2026, new DStv customers can purchase an HD decoder, dish kit and one-month DStv Yanga subscription for N15,000, while new GOtv customers can get a GOtv decoder, antenna and one-month GOtv Jolli subscription for N15,000.

The offer comes as anticipation builds for the 2026 FIFA World Cup, which will be hosted by the United States, Mexico and Canada. The tournament, the biggest in FIFA World Cup history, will feature 48 national teams, including 10 African nations, competing across 104 matches over 39 days.

Commenting on the offer, Chief Executive Officer of MultiChoice Nigeria, Kemi Omotosho, said the company is focused on making the FIFA World Cup experience more accessible to football fans across the country.

“The FIFA World Cup is more than just a tournament – it’s a shared global moment. Our goal is to ensure that fans in Nigeria can experience every goal, every story and every unforgettable moment as it happens. Through our special World Cup bundle offers, we are making it more affordable for customers to get connected ahead of the tournament,” she stated.

As Africa’s home of football, SuperSport on DStv will deliver comprehensive, round-the-clock coverage of the tournament. Viewers will enjoy live broadcasts of all 104 FIFA World Cup matches, four dedicated 24-hour World Cup channels and a bonus pop-up channel showcasing the best moments in World Cup history. To make navigation easier, selected SuperSport channels will be renamed for the duration of the tournament, ensuring customers can easily find and follow the action.

Beyond the live matches, viewers will enjoy a rich slate of FIFA World Cup programming, including match highlights, expert analysis, exclusive tournament magazine shows, African football stories and behind-the-scenes content.

The World Cup coverage on SuperSport will also feature multiple language commentary options, including pidgin delivered through a distinct Pan-African lens, featuring top local commentators.

Customers will also have the flexibility to watch the tournament their way through Live TV, Catch Up, replays and on DStv Stream, ensuring they never miss a moment of the action, whether at home or on the move.
